Using the formula for desired FiO2, if PaO2 desired is 100 mmHg, FiO2 known is 0.40, and PaO2 known is 80 mmHg, what is the required FiO2?

Explanation:
The idea is to adjust FiO2 in proportion to the change in PaO2, assuming a roughly linear relationship within the practical range. You scale the known FiO2 by the ratio of the desired PaO2 to the current PaO2. FiO2 desired = FiO2 known × (PaO2 desired / PaO2 known) = 0.40 × (100 / 80) = 0.40 × 1.25 = 0.50 So the required FiO2 is 0.50.
